The "anchor" anterior capsulectomy

R R Berger1, A M Kenyeres

  • 1Eye Division, Boksburg-Benoni Hospital, South Africa.

Ophthalmic Surgery
|November 1, 1994
PubMed
Summary

A novel anchor anterior capsulectomy (AAC) offers a safe alternative to continuous circular capsulorhexis (CCC) for cataract surgery. This technique reduces the risk of corneal endothelial injury and postoperative edema, ensuring successful intraocular lens implantation.

Background:

  • Continuous circular capsulorhexis (CCC) is a common but challenging anterior capsulectomy technique.
  • Surgeons may experience difficulty with CCC, particularly in lower semicircular tearing, leading to corneal endothelial injury and edema.

Purpose of the Study:

  • To introduce and evaluate a modified anterior capsulectomy technique, the anchor anterior capsulectomy (AAC).
  • To assess the safety and efficacy of AAC as an alternative to CCC in cataract extraction.

Main Methods:

  • The AAC technique involves a crescent capsulorhexis and perpendicular discission, followed by circular tearing of capsular flaps.
  • AAC was performed in 14 cases of elective extracapsular cataract extraction with intraocular lens (IOL) implantation.

Main Results:

  • Capsulectomy was successful in 12 out of 14 cases.
  • Intraocular lens implantation was successful in all 12 cases where capsulectomy was successful.
  • The procedure facilitated good "in-the-bag" IOL implantation, irrespective of IOL size.

Conclusions:

  • Anchor anterior capsulectomy (AAC) is a reliable and relatively easy-to-perform alternative anterior capsulectomy.
  • AAC can be utilized as an intermediate step for surgeons learning continuous circular capsulorhexis (CCC).
  • The technique shows promise in reducing complications associated with traditional CCC.
